Factors to Consider When Choosing Recovery Tools for the Winter Training Season

When selecting recovery tools for winter training, I focus on factors like temperature compatibility and ease of use to guarantee they work effectively in cold conditions. Portability and size matter too, especially if I need to carry them around or store them easily. I also consider material safety and whether the tools offer versatile functions to get the most benefit from my recovery routine.

Temperature Compatibility

Choosing recovery tools that are temperature-compatible is essential during winter training, as extreme cold can compromise their effectiveness. I look for tools that can maintain cold temperatures for at least 2-6 hours, ensuring consistent cold therapy. Features like gel cores or stainless steel construction help retain temperature, providing reliable hot or cold therapy even in low temperatures. It’s also important that these tools can be easily warmed or chilled in household appliances like freezers or hot water without damage. Portability matters too; I prefer lightweight tools that work well in cold environments without becoming brittle or losing function. Finally, I prioritize materials that are safe, so they won’t freeze or overheat unexpectedly, keeping my recovery safe and effective in all winter conditions.

Durability and Maintenance

Selecting recovery tools that stand up to harsh winter conditions requires attention to durability and maintenance. I look for tools made from sturdy materials like stainless steel, high-density foam, or solid rubber, which resist cold temperatures and frequent use. Regular cleaning with mild detergent or alcohol wipes keeps them hygienic and prevents buildup that can cause damage. Proper storage in a cool, dry place is essential to prevent rust, moisture damage, or warping—especially for metal or foam equipment. I also inspect my tools regularly for cracks, loose parts, or signs of wear to guarantee safety and performance. Choosing tools with replaceable or washable components makes maintenance easier and extends their lifespan, saving me money and ensuring reliable recovery during the winter training season.

Aromatherapy Benefits

In winter training, the right recovery tools do more than just ease muscle soreness—they can also boost overall well-being through aromatherapy benefits. Using essential oils like eucalyptus, lavender, and peppermint during recovery can promote relaxation and reduce muscle tension. Certain scents, such as eucalyptus and menthol, help open airways and improve breathing, making recovery more comfortable. Inhalation of these oils stimulates the limbic system, which reduces stress and elevates mood, supporting mental health after intense workouts. Aromatherapy-infused recovery tools provide a calming sensory experience, making post-exercise routines more enjoyable. Scientific studies confirm that aromatherapy can lower cortisol levels, helping to decrease stress and enhance both physical and mental recovery.
